Keys To Effective Resolution Of Staff Conflict In Christian Schools, Sandra De Jong
Keys To Effective Resolution Of Staff Conflict In Christian Schools, Sandra De Jong
Master of Education Program Theses
The purpose of this project is to outline some keys to effective resolution of staff conflict in Christian schools. This project begins by introducing the problems that can occur in Christian community when conflict does not get resolved effectively. This is followed up by a closer look at God's will and purpose for Christian community in resolving conflicts that may threaten to tear them apart. This discussion is followed up with the identification of the characteristics of conflict and the trends that people generally follow when seeking to resolve their conflicts.
